    Re: new mobo......

    Hi,

    M$ won't deal with it now. They have handed all responsibility for oem preinstalls to the oem.

    You will need to contact Acer and explain you need to change your mobo.

    The recovery disc will not work with a different mobo.

    Acer may send you one that will.

    Otherwise, get hold of a Vista install disc - the right bit version (32 or 64 bit ) .Install using that and the product key stickered on your laptop.

    You will probably need to call Acer to activate it.

    Hope it helps

    Re: new mobo......

    Hello thepizzaman,

    Since the product key number is tied to only the original computer for a OEM, you usually will not be able to use it again unless the OEM is willing to activate it for you.

    I would contact the OEM Acer, and let them know what motherboard you plan on upgrading to see if they will do a phone activation for you first to see if you can or not.

    Good luck. I hope they will activate it for you.
